android常用控件 屬性和事件說明

android常用控件
Android控件之Spinner探究
摘要: 以下模擬下拉列表的用法佈局文件<?xml version="1.0" encoding="utf-8"?><LinearLayout android:id="@+id/LinearLayout01" android:layout_width="fill_parent" android:layout_height="fill_parent" android:orientation="vertical" xmlns:android="http://sc閱讀全文
posted @ 2011-02-24 16:58 Ruthless 閱讀(5195) | 評論 (0) 編輯
Android控件之TabHost探究
摘要: 以下通過TabHost實現android選項卡。main.xml佈局文件<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="fill_parent"> <LinearLayout an閱讀全文
posted @ 2011-02-24 16:20 Ruthless 閱讀(3096) | 評論 (0) 編輯
Android控件之Gallery探究
摘要: Gallery組件主要用於橫向顯示圖像列表,不過按常規做法。Gallery組件只能有限地顯示指定的圖像。也就是說,如果爲Gallery組件指定了10張圖像,那麼當Gallery組件顯示到第10張時,就不會再繼續顯示了。這雖然在大多數時候沒有什麼關係,但在某些情況下,我們希望圖像顯示到最後一張時再重第1張開始顯示,也就是循環顯示。要實現這種風格的Gallery組件,就需要對Gallery的Adapter對象進行一番改進。以下通過Gallery模擬循環顯示圖像,在單擊某一個Gallery組件中的圖像時在下方顯示一個放大的圖像(使用ImageSwitcher組件)。目錄結構main.xml佈局文件.閱讀全文
posted @ 2011-02-24 11:29 Ruthless 閱讀(3885) | 評論 (3) 編輯
Android控件之ProgressBar探究
摘要: ProgressBar位於android.widget包下,其繼承於View,主要用於顯示一些操作的進度。應用程序可以修改其長度表示當前後臺操作的完成情況。因爲進度條會移動,所以長時間加載某些資源或者執行某些耗時的操作時,不會使用戶界面失去響應。ProgressBar類的使用非常簡單,只需將其顯示到前臺,然後啓動一個後臺線程定時更改表示進度的數值即可。以下ProgressBar跟Handle結合,模擬進度條的使用,當進度條完成時會跳轉到TestActivitymain.xml佈局文件<?xml version="1.0" encoding="utf-8&qu閱讀全文
posted @ 2011-02-23 19:23 Ruthless 閱讀(3611) | 評論 (0) 編輯
Android控件之GridView探究
摘要: GridView是一項顯示二維的viewgroup,可滾動的網格。一般用來顯示多張圖片。以下模擬九宮圖的實現,當鼠標點擊圖片時會進行相應的跳轉鏈接。目錄結構main.xml佈局文件,存放GridView控件<?xml version="1.0" encoding="utf-8"?><!-- android:numColumns="auto_fit" ,GridView的列數設置爲自動 android:columnWidth="90dp",每列的寬度,也就是Item的寬度android:stretc閱讀全文
posted @ 2011-02-23 17:44 Ruthless 閱讀(17311) | 評論 (7) 編輯
Android控件之ListView探究二
摘要: 目錄結構main.xml佈局文件<?xml version="1.0" encoding="utf-8"?><!-- 使用相對佈局 --><R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="wrap_content" android:layout_height=&q閱讀全文
posted @ 2011-02-23 14:58 Ruthless 閱讀(3020) | 評論 (0) 編輯
Android控件之ListView探究一
摘要: 在android開發中ListView是比較常用的組件,它以列表的形式展示具體內容,並且能夠根據數據的長度自適應顯示。main.xml佈局文件[代碼]my_listitem.xml佈局文件[代碼]LsActivity類[代碼]運行結果閱讀全文
posted @ 2011-02-22 10:48 Ruthless 閱讀(2785) | 評論 (0) 編輯
Android控件之ScrollView探究
摘要: ScrollView滾動視圖是指當擁有很多內容,屏幕顯示不完時,需要通過滾動跳來顯示的視圖。ScrollView只支持垂直滾動。以下爲案例main.xml佈局文件[代碼]顯示效果閱讀全文
posted @ 2011-02-22 10:29 Ruthless 閱讀(2835) | 評論 (1) 編輯
Android控件之AutoCompleteTextView、MultiAutoCompleteTextView探究
摘要: 在Android中提供了兩種智能輸入框,它們是AutoCompleteTextView、MultiAutoCompleteTextView。它們的功能大致一樣。顯示效果像Google搜索一樣,當你在搜索框裏輸入一些字符時(至少兩個字符),會自動彈出一個下拉框提示類似的結果。下面詳細介紹一下。一、AutoCompleteTextView1、簡介一個繼承自EditView的可編輯的文本視圖,能夠實現動態匹配輸入的內容。如google搜索引擎當輸入文本時可以根據內容顯示匹配的熱門信息。2、重要方法 clearListSelection():清除選中的列表項dismissDropDown():如果存在閱讀全文
posted @ 2011-02-22 09:52 Ruthless 閱讀(5585) | 評論 (3) 編輯
Android控件之DatePicker、TimePicker探究
摘要: 一、DatePicker繼承自FrameLayout類,日期選擇控件的主要功能是向用戶提供包含年、月、日的日期數據並允許用戶對其修改。如果要捕獲用戶修改日期選擇控件中的數據事件,需要爲DatePicker添加OnDateChangedListener監聽器。二、TimePicker也繼承自FrameLayout類。時間選擇控件向用戶顯示一天中的時間(可以爲24小時,也可以爲AM/PM制),並允許用戶進行選擇。如果要捕獲用戶修改時間數據的事件,便需要爲TimePicker添加OnTimeChangedListener監聽器以下模擬日期與時間選擇控件的用法目錄結構main.xml佈局文件[代碼]D閱讀全文
posted @ 2011-02-21 21:54 Ruthless 閱讀(19988) | 評論 (2) 編輯
Android控件之AnalogClock、DigitalClock探究
摘要: 時鐘控件包括AnalogClock和DigitalClock,它們都負責顯示時鐘,所不同的是AnalogClock控件顯示模擬時鐘,且只顯示時針和分針,而DigitalClock顯示數字時鐘,可精確到秒以下模擬時鐘的用法目錄結構佈局文件[代碼]運行結果閱讀全文
posted @ 2011-02-21 21:39 Ruthless 閱讀(3503) | 評論 (0) 編輯
Android控件之ImageView探究
摘要: ImageView控件是一個圖片控件,負責顯示圖片。以下模擬手機圖片查看器目錄結構main.xml佈局文件[代碼]ImageViewActivity類[代碼]運行結果閱讀全文
posted @ 2011-02-21 21:29 Ruthless 閱讀(3086) | 評論 (0) 編輯
Android控件之CheckBox、RadioButton探究
摘要: CheckBox和RadioButton控件都只有選中和未選中狀態,不同的是RadioButton是單選按鈕,需要編制到一個RadioGroup中,同一時刻一個RadioGroup中只能有一個按鈕處於選中狀態。以下爲CheckBox和RadioButton常用方法及說明以下爲單選按鈕和複選按鈕的使用方法目錄結構main.xml佈局文件[代碼]CbRbActivity類[代碼]運行結果閱讀全文
posted @ 2011-02-21 21:20 Ruthless 閱讀(2714) | 評論 (0) 編輯
Android控件之ToggleButton探究
摘要: ToggleButton的狀態只能是選中和未選中,並且需要爲不同的狀態設置不同的顯示文本。以下案例爲ToggleButton的用法目錄結構main.xml佈局文件[代碼]ToggleButtonActivity類[代碼]運行效果:閱讀全文
posted @ 2011-02-21 20:54 Ruthless 閱讀(4222) | 評論 (0) 編輯
Android控件之EditView探究
摘要: EditView類繼承自TextView類,EditView與TextView最大的不同就是用戶可以對EditView控件進行編輯,同時還可以爲EditView控件設置監聽器,用來判斷用戶的輸入是否合法。 以下爲EditView常用屬性及對應方法說明閱讀全文
posted @ 2011-02-20 22:30 Ruthless 閱讀(3506) | 評論 (0) 編輯
Android控件之TextView探究
摘要: 在android中,文本控件主要包括TextView控件和EditView控件,本節先對TextView控件的用法進行詳細介紹。 TextView類繼承自View類,TextView控件的功能是向用戶顯示文本的內容,但不允許編輯,而其子類EditView允許用戶進行編輯。 以下爲TextView常用屬性及對應方法說明閱讀全文
posted @ 2011-02-20 22:13 Ruthless 閱讀(2856) | 評論 (0) 編輯
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章